Description

wood, metal, closed oval ring, tube-shaped, getting broader to the front, the original coating of highly polished discs of coconut shells now missing, the grooved structure originating from the discs still visible on the surface of the wood, old label;
the capture of a head was an essential requirement of coming of age in old Nias. It marked the entry of the young warrior into manhood, and announced his status as an eligible desirable bachelor.
